Dennis Murphy founded Ventry Associates in 1999. He began with a vision to create a company that would provide multiple services - Public Relations, Lobbying, and Business Development, to clients across a diverse range of industries. Since then, nearly 23 years have passed, and Ventry Associates has had a proven track record of success that few, if any other firms, can match.

Prior to founding Ventry, Dennis served in the Massachusetts State Legislature for six years representing the 9th Hampden District. In only his second term, he was selected by the House Speaker to serve as Vice Chairman of the Joint Committee on Energy, and in his third term, was elevated to Chairman of the Joint Committee on Energy. During his tenure as Chairman he oversaw numerous legislative initiatives regarding the energy industries.

Dennis holds a Bachelor of Science in Business Administration with a concentration in Marketing from American International College. He is also a founder and incorporator of New Valley Bank, and in addition is part of the ownership group of the Springfield Thunderbirds, the American Hockey League affiliate of the St. Louis Blues.

Camp is currently the managing partner at Corporate Relations Management, a government relations firm based in Canton, MS. Previously Camp served as a Policy Advisor in the office of Governor Phil Bryant where he handled military policy, public safety, corrections, emergency management, and budget policy. Prior to joining the Governor's staff in January, 2012, Camp spent more than five years working as a Budget Analyst at the Legislative Budget Office, where his duties included helping state leaders prepare Mississippi's budget. Camp earned a Master's in Business Administration and a Bachelor's Degree in Business Management, with a minor in Communications, from Mississippi State University. Camp was appointed Chairman of Bully Bloc, one of the state's largest PACs, in late 2017. Bully Bloc is a Political Action Committee dedicated to the success of Mississippi State University and all Institutions of Higher Learning within the state. Camp served as Chairman of Bully Bloc through the 2019 election cycle and remains on the board. He also serves on the board of Improve Mississippi Political Action Committee (IMPAC). He and his wife, Sydney reside in Madison, Mississippi with daughter, Gray, and son, John Burke.

John E. Murphy is co-founder of Murphy Donoghue Partners and an attorney specializing in the fields of state and municipal government relations in Massachusetts. Jack possesses more than thirty-five years' experience in the state government, including fourteen years in the Massachusetts House of Representatives as a state representative from the North shore area of Boston. Since 1985, Jack has maintained an office on Boston's Beacon Hill where his practice, Issues Management Group, has represented a variety of clients on issues concerning health care, technology, the environment, transportation, construction, manufacturing, financial services, employment and general business matters. He has also represented many non-profit entities pro bono.

From 1971 through 1984, Jack held the positions of Majority Leader, Majority Whip, Chairman of the Committee on Bills in the Third Reading, and member of the Committee on Banks and Banking. He was also a member of the Executive Committee of the Council of State Governments, Eastern Region; was a member of the Executive Committee of the National Conference of State Legislatures; and has held various positions within the Democratic National Committee, including membership on the Platform Committee and Rules Committee.
